> I have a class that evaluates an XPath expression against an XML stream
> with multiple namespaces and returns a NodeList. I know by looking at
> the XML that the node I am retrieving is composed of 20 elements, called
> '<summary>'. I also know that two of those elements have no value. The
> relevant code looks like this:
>
>
> XML2Doc xmldoc = new XML2Doc(getXmlFile());
> Document domTree = (Document) xmldoc.getDoc();
> domTree.getDocumentElement().normalize();
> NamespaceResolver myResolver = new NamespaceResolver();
> XObject xObj = XPathAPI.eval(domTree,getXpathExp(),myResolver);
> NodeList = xObj.nodelist();
>
>
>
>
>
> The problem I am running into is that of the 20 <summary> elements some
> are empty (<summary type="html"></summary>). Upon evaluating the XPath
> expression the NodeList returned only 18 items event though I know there
> are twenty. It seems that the elements that weren't valued became
> insignificant as the NodeList was generated.
>
> Is this the correct behavior? I'm expecting my NodeList to have the
> same number of <summary> elements because I'll be matching them against
> their related <title> elements during presentation time. Perhaps there
> is something I need to do in my code to establish the fact that empty
> elements are significant and should be included in the NodeList? I
> tried removing the normalize() call but that didn't help.
